Latest Patents
Lisa S. Walko holds a patent for a "System and method for movie transaction processing." This invention provides a comprehensive solution for tracking and processing transactions related to movie viewing. The system allows for the creation of billing records and the detection of potential fraudulent activities. It specifically relates to processing transactions for video content distributed digitally, such as on a digital video disc (DVD) in a scrambled format. This method offers an alternative to traditional viewing methods, including video tapes and pay-per-view services. The system enables users to establish multiple accesses to a service with a single authorization, streamlining the user experience.
